ABSTRACT
There are various criteria that could be used to rate a tertiary institution. One of these is the productivity of the members of staff which is shown by the research conducted; publications submitted and manuscripts published in indexed journals. Manuscripts submitted and published in one of the highly rated indexed journals in our locality were analysed with a view to identifying how the institutions add to knowledge by their contributions. Our findings show that the four top-rated institutions in terms of manuscripts published in West African Journal of Medicine (WAJM) are University College Hospital (UCH); lbadan; University of Ilorin Teaching Hospital (UITH); Obafemi Awolowo University Teaching Hospital (OAUTH); and Jos University Teaching Hospital (JUTH)
